Straightforward Tips for Enhanced Psychological Wellness
Prioritizing your mindset doesn't have to be challenging. There are several readily available approaches to cultivate a more healthy perspective. Consider incorporating regular physical activity into your routine – even a short walk can make a real difference. Furthermore, ensure you’’re getting enough deep rest each evening and consciously practice focusing on the now. Don't forget the importance of connecting with loved ones; genuine human interaction is essential for a robust connection. Finally, be kind; self-compassion is a key instrument for coping with life's difficulties.

Emotional Health: Breaking the Taboo
For too many years, conversations surrounding mental health have been shrouded in secrecy, fostering a damaging taboo that prevents individuals from seeking the help they desperately need. This barrier often stems from a lack of awareness and pervasive erroneous ideas about conditions like depression, anxiety, and bipolar disorder. It's crucial that we actively question these harmful beliefs and promote open, honest dialogue about psychological wellness. Education is key – providing information and avenues for knowing can drastically reduce the worry associated with seeking therapeutic intervention. Ultimately, creating a more caring and accepting society requires us to dismantle the psychological taboo brick by brick, fostering an environment where seeking help is viewed as a sign of strength, not weakness.
